Pennsylvania's four distinct seasons, from snowy winters to warm summers, mean your bay windows need to be built for both comfort and efficiency. This is especially true for homes in Philadelphia, where maintaining consistent indoor temperatures is key to managing energy bills. Look for windows with excellent insulation and robust sealing to combat winter drafts and summer heat. Permitting in Pennsylvania, and particularly within Philadelphia, can have specific requirements for window installations, including historical district guidelines. When evaluating providers, ask about their familiarity with these local regulations and their experience selecting window products that will perform well year-round. The cost to install a bay window in Pennsylvania is influenced by several factors. These include the size and style of the window, the complexity of the installation, and the quality of the materials chosen. Labor costs for bay window installation in Pennsylvania are primarily driven by the complexity of the installation. Factors such as the window's size, whether structural modifications are needed, and the accessibility of the installation site will affect the time and effort required.
